    Mud Crab Adventures - Port Smith

    29 июля 2021 г., Австралия ⋅ ⛅ 21 °C

    We hit up the lagoon at low tide and thought we would try our hand at ‘hooking’ mud crabs. After exploring the mud flats for a while we did not have much luck, but then I (Lauren) stumbled upon a monster hiding in a rock cave. Brett tried his best with the wire hook, but we could not get him out, eventually he went deep into the cave where we couldn’t see him anymore. We were devastated, but it motivated us all to come back out tonight on the next low tide and try again.

    Although, the morning crabbing mission was unsuccessful, we found a heap of other cool things in the rock pools. The most exciting was the Lion Fish, which are extremely venomous, but very beautiful, the footage doesn’t do it justice. We also found turtles and a stingray stranded in the tidal pools.

    After dinner, we set off with our torches ready to get the big monster mud crab. We did not get the one we were hunting, another crab had moved into his hole, but we cleaned up. We caught 3 mud crabs the last one having the biggest claws on it we have ever seen. One of its claws was the size of Brett’s hand. To say that Brett was happy was an understatement.

    Brett cleaned them up and cooked chilli mud crab for tea the next night and could not stop talking about how this was the mud crab of his dreams. Let’s just say he was lucky to have me there as a spotter or he would have none 😉.

    Camel Ride on Cable Beach

    3 августа 2021 г., Австралия ⋅ ⛅ 28 °C

    Brett and I weren’t keen at first on riding the camels, but the kids were. When Kat went on to book the camel ride Brett and I decided last minute to go with the kids and I am glad we did, it was a lot of fun.

    On our first visit to cable beach Kat and the kids went for a walk and worked out which camels they wanted to ride. They chose the only company that has the camels lay down for you to hop on and off. This made it feel more authentic, it was also the scariest part as it feels like you are going to get tipped right off the very tall animal. Brax and I were very lucky, we got to be on the lead camel Jimmy.

    We went for a 30min ride along Cable Beach where we got to see see some beautiful views of the ocean and some not so beautiful views of nudists 😂😂, the kids did find this quite funny though.

    After our ride we stayed and had dinner and drinks on the beach and watched the sun go down, a perfect way to end the day.

    Derby - The Boab Prison Tree

    20 августа 2021 г., Австралия ⋅ ☀️ 33 °C

    On the way into Derby we stopped to check out the Boab Prison Tree. Then we headed into town to do jobs 🙄. The kids thought the prison tree was cool, but didn’t believe me at first when I told them what it use to be used for, then they read the information board!

    ‘The Boab Prison Tree, also known as Kunumudj is believed to be 1,500 years old.

    This remarkable tree has a circumference of over 14 metres and has an oblong slit in the bark, through which the hollow centre is visible - this is common among older boab trees when the soft spongy trunk tissue dies off, causing the trunk to become hollow.

    The Boab Prison Tree is a culturally significant site for the local Nyikina people and is also important in the story of the early settlement of Derby and the region’s pastoral industry. It is known to have been used for several different purposes - accounts from the early 1900’s indicate that the tree had been in use by local Aboriginal people, whether as a resting place or a sacred place is unclear. The tree and adjacent Myalls Bore were also the last overnight stop for local pastoralists droving cattle to the port at Derby. The Boab prison tree is also said to have been used as a prison, or as a holding area for Aboriginal prisoners being transported long distances to the gaol at Derby.’
